2.Place piston at top dead center. Remove muffler (A) and heat shield (B).
3.Use a wood or plastic scraping tool to clean deposits from cylinder exhaust port.
IMPORTANT
Never use a metal tool to scrape carbon from the exhaust port. Do not scratch the cylinder or piston when cleaning the exhaust port. Do not allow carbon particles to enter the cylinder.
4.Inspect heat shield, and replace if damaged.
5.Install heat shield and muffler.
